Claims (5)
- 空気濾過および空気浄化装置において、
上部、底部、側面、および後部を有する筐体;
前記筐体に配置された第1の風洞;
前記筐体に配置された第2の風洞;
前記第2の風洞から前記第1の風洞を分けるディバイダーであって、前記ディバイダーは、回転可能な制振器を含み、前記制振器は:
全体的に前記第1の風洞を通る空気の流れを遮断する遮断位置まで回転するように構成され、かつ全体的に空気が前記第1の風洞を貫流できるようにする通過位置まで回転するように構成された第1の部材;
全体的に前記第2の風洞を通る空気の流れを遮断する遮断位置まで回転するように構成され、かつ全体的に空気が前記第2の風洞を貫流できるようにする通過位置まで回転するように構成された第2の部材
を含む、ディバイダー;
前記第1の風洞と直接流体連通するように配置された第1のフィルタ;
前記第2の風洞と直接流体連通するように配置された第2のフィルタ;
前記第1の部材が通過位置にあり、かつ前記第2の部材が遮断位置にあるときに、空気を前記周囲環境から全体的に前記第1の風洞まで引き入れ、および前記第1のフィルタを通って前記周囲環境に至るようにするように構成された送風器であって;また、前記第1の部材が遮断位置にあり、かつ前記第2の部材が通過位置にあるときに、空気を前記周囲環境から全体的に前記第2の風洞まで引き入れ、および前記第2のフィルタを通って前記周囲環境に至るようにするように構成されている送風器;
前記送風器の起動および作動停止、および前記第1および第2の部材の位置を制御する制御システム
を含むことを特徴とする、空気濾過および空気浄化装置。 - 請求項1に記載の空気濾過および空気浄化装置において、さらに、前記第1の送風器に引き入れられる空気が濾過されるように配置された第1の前置きフィルタ;および
前記第2の送風器に引き入れられる空気が濾過されるように配置された第2の前置きフィルタ;
を含むことを特徴とする、空気濾過および空気浄化装置。 - 請求項1に記載の空気濾過および空気浄化装置において、前記第1のフィルタが、99.975%定格のHEPAクラスのフィルタであり、および前記第2のフィルタが、HEPAクラスのフィルタであることを特徴とする、空気濾過および空気浄化装置。
- 請求項1に記載の空気濾過および空気浄化装置において、前記第1のフィルタが、前記第2のフィルタよりも高いHEPAクラスを有することを特徴とする、空気濾過および空気浄化装置。
- 請求項2に記載の空気濾過および空気浄化装置において、前記第1および第2の前置きフィルタが、少なくとも99.997%定格のHEPAクラスのフィルタであることを特徴とする、空気濾過および空気浄化装置。
